“Dreiling’s Two-Run Homer Swings Momentum Towards Tennessee in Third Inning”

Tennessee began the game by loading the bases in the opening inning, managing to score a run but ultimately leaving them stranded. Alabama quickly responded in the bottom of the first inning with a home run from TJ McCants. Ian Petrutz then added a solo home run of his own, putting the Crimson Tide ahead 2-1 as they headed into the second inning.

In the second inning, Alabama positioned runners for scoring opportunities, but Causey delivered a crucial strikeout to close the inning, preventing further damage.

Dylan Dreiling shifted the momentum back to Tennessee in the third inning with a two-run homer.

Blake Burke extended Tennessee’s lead in the fourth inning with a two-run home run, pushing the score to 5-2. The Vols continued to add runs with a two-out rally in the fifth inning. Cannon Peebles singled to bring Dreiling home, followed by a double from Dalton Bargo that scored Dean Curley and Peebles.

The offensive display persisted as Kavares Tears contributed a two-run homer, increasing Tennessee’s lead to 10-2 by the seventh inning.
